| A great tour through Manhattan where you will se and recognize famous spots from your favourite movies and TV-shows. Also interesting are some of the trivia you get with it, such as what Hitch and Ghostbusters have in common, errors on the set of the Cosby show and Friends, plus a nice trip through Midtown, Chelsea, SoHo, The Village and TriBeCa. Make sure your host is Kimberley, for a neverending stream of enthousiastic and in-depth knowledge on what you see.
Very much recognizable and recommendable! |

| Start spreading the news - this is a wonderful way to experience New York for the first time. As Canadians we see New York through film and tv often.
So, to actually see neighbourhoods, eat pizza, and see movie/tv sights in 'real life' was great.
Brian, a native NY-er was our guide and he gave us so many 'back stories' and tidbits and it was a great tour. And he told us the 'truth' about many tv shows that we were pained to hear - 'Friends fans be warned'!
We started off with breakfast at Ellen's Stardust Diner as that was going to be our 9:30AM meeting location - we would never have picked that spot and it was such a fun way to start the day!
We really liked Brians' s humour, good grace - as we had a 3 month old baby with us, and his verrrrrrry informative narrative.
We had a great time!! |

| This was a fun tour and the tour guide did a great job. She showed clips of the movies along the way, so we could see how they looked on screen. It is a great way to see a lot of sights and neighborhoods in a short period of time.
I wish we had done this on the first day of our trip, because we had already seen some of the popular attractions. Other than that, we would recommend the tour to anyone who loves movies or just wants to see New York City! |
